成人性生交大片免费看视频r_亚洲综合极品香蕉久久网_在线视频免费观看一区_亚洲精品亚洲人成人网在线播放_国产精品毛片av_久久久久国产精品www_亚洲国产一区二区三区在线播_日韩一区二区三区四区区区_亚洲精品国产无套在线观_国产免费www

主頁 > 知識庫 > MySQL查詢優(yōu)化之查詢慢原因和解決技巧

MySQL查詢優(yōu)化之查詢慢原因和解決技巧

熱門標(biāo)簽:武漢網(wǎng)絡(luò)外呼系統(tǒng)服務(wù)商 啥是企業(yè)400電話辦理 怎樣在地圖標(biāo)注銷售區(qū)域 外呼系統(tǒng)打電話上限是多少 百應(yīng)電話機(jī)器人優(yōu)勢 電話外呼系統(tǒng)改號 曲靖移動外呼系統(tǒng)公司 南昌三維地圖標(biāo)注 地圖標(biāo)注費(fèi)用是多少

在做開發(fā)的朋友特別是和mysql有接觸的朋友會碰到有時mysql查詢很慢,當(dāng)然我指的是大數(shù)據(jù)量百萬千萬級了,不是幾十條了,

下面我們來看看解決查詢慢的辦法

會經(jīng)常發(fā)現(xiàn)開發(fā)人員查一下沒用索引的語句或者沒有l(wèi)imit n的語句,這些沒語句會對數(shù)據(jù)庫造成很大的影響,例如一個幾千萬條記錄的大表要全部掃描,或者是不停的做filesort,對數(shù)據(jù)庫和服務(wù)器造成io影響等。這是鏡像庫上面的情況。

而到了線上庫,除了出現(xiàn)沒有索引的語句,沒有用limit的語句,還多了一個情況,mysql連接數(shù)過多的問題。說到這里,先來看看以前我們的監(jiān)控做法 :

  1. 部署zabbix等開源分布式監(jiān)控系統(tǒng),獲取每天的數(shù)據(jù)庫的io,cpu,連接數(shù)
  2. 部署每周性能統(tǒng)計,包含數(shù)據(jù)增加量,iostat,vmstat,datasize的情況
  3. Mysql slowlog收集,列出top 10

以前以為做了這些監(jiān)控已經(jīng)是很完美了,現(xiàn)在部署了mysql節(jié)點進(jìn)程監(jiān)控之后,才發(fā)現(xiàn)很多弊端

  • 第一種做法的弊端: zabbix太龐大,而且不是在mysql內(nèi)部做的監(jiān)控,很多數(shù)據(jù)不是非常準(zhǔn)備,現(xiàn)在一般都是用來查閱歷史的數(shù)據(jù)情況
  • 第二種做法的弊端:因為是每周只跑一次,很多情況沒法發(fā)現(xiàn)和報警
  • 第三種做法的弊端: 當(dāng)節(jié)點的slowlog非常多的時候,top10就變得沒意義了,而且很多時候會給出那些是一定要跑的定期任務(wù)語句給你。。參考的價值不大

那么我們怎么來解決和查詢這些問題呢

對于排查問題找出性能瓶頸來說,最容易發(fā)現(xiàn)并解決的問題就是MYSQL的慢查詢以及沒有得用索引的查詢。
OK,開始找出mysql中執(zhí)行起來不“爽”的SQL語句吧。

方法一: 這個方法我正在用,呵呵,比較喜歡這種即時性的。

Mysql5.0以上的版本可以支持將執(zhí)行比較慢的SQL語句記錄下來。

mysql> show variables like 'long%'; 注:這個long_query_time是用來定義慢于多少秒的才算“慢查詢”
+-----------------+-----------+
| Variable_name | Value |
+-----------------+-----------+
| long_query_time | 10.000000 |
+-----------------+-----------+
1 row in set (0.00 sec)
mysql> set long_query_time=1; 注: 我設(shè)置了1, 也就是執(zhí)行時間超過1秒的都算慢查詢。
Query OK, 0 rows affected (0.00 sec)
mysql> show variables like 'slow%';
+---------------------+---------------+
| Variable_name | Value |
+---------------------+---------------+
| slow_launch_time | 2 |
| slow_query_log | ON | 注:是否打開日志記錄

| slow_query_log_file | /tmp/slow.log | 注: 設(shè)置到什么位置
+---------------------+---------------+
3 rows in set (0.00 sec)
mysql> set global slow_query_log='ON' 注:打開日志記錄

一旦slow_query_log變量被設(shè)置為ON,mysql會立即開始記錄。
/etc/my.cnf 里面可以設(shè)置上面MYSQL全局變量的初始值。
long_query_time=1
slow_query_log_file=/tmp/slow.log

方法二:mysqldumpslow命令

/path/mysqldumpslow -s c -t 10 /tmp/slow-log
這會輸出記錄次數(shù)最多的10條SQL語句,其中:
-s, 是表示按照何種方式排序,c、t、l、r分別是按照記錄次數(shù)、時間、查詢時間、返回的記錄數(shù)來排序,ac、atal、ar,表示相應(yīng)的倒敘;
-t, 是top n的意思,即為返回前面多少條的數(shù)據(jù);
-g, 后邊可以寫一個正則匹配模式,大小寫不敏感的;
比如
/path/mysqldumpslow -s r -t 10 /tmp/slow-log
得到返回記錄集最多的10個查詢。
/path/mysqldumpslow -s t -t 10 -g “l(fā)eft join” /tmp/slow-log
得到按照時間排序的前10條里面含有左連接的查詢語句。 最后總結(jié)一下節(jié)點監(jiān)控的好處

  1. 輕量級的監(jiān)控,而且是實時的,還可以根據(jù)實際的情況來定制和修改
  2. 設(shè)置了過濾程序,可以對那些一定要跑的語句進(jìn)行過濾
  3. 及時發(fā)現(xiàn)那些沒有用索引,或者是不合法的查詢,雖然這很耗時去處理那些慢語句,但這樣可以避免數(shù)據(jù)庫掛掉,還是值得的
  4. 在數(shù)據(jù)庫出現(xiàn)連接數(shù)過多的時候,程序會自動保存當(dāng)前數(shù)據(jù)庫的processlist,DBA進(jìn)行原因查找的時候這可是利器
  5. 使用mysqlbinlog 來分析的時候,可以得到明確的數(shù)據(jù)庫狀態(tài)異常的時間段

有些人會建義我們來做mysql配置文件設(shè)置

調(diào)節(jié)tmp_table_size的時候發(fā)現(xiàn)另外一些參數(shù)
Qcache_queries_in_cache在緩存中已注冊的查詢數(shù)目
Qcache_inserts被加入到緩存中的查詢數(shù)目
Qcache_hits緩存采樣數(shù)數(shù)目
Qcache_lowmem_prunes因為缺少內(nèi)存而被從緩存中刪除的查詢數(shù)目
Qcache_not_cached沒有被緩存的查詢數(shù)目 (不能被緩存的,或由于 QUERY_CACHE_TYPE)
Qcache_free_memory查詢緩存的空閑內(nèi)存總數(shù)
Qcache_free_blocks查詢緩存中的空閑內(nèi)存塊的數(shù)目
Qcache_total_blocks查詢緩存中的塊的總數(shù)目
Qcache_free_memory可以緩存一些常用的查詢,如果是常用的sql會被裝載到內(nèi)存。那樣會增加數(shù)據(jù)庫訪問速度。

到此這篇關(guān)于MySQL查詢優(yōu)化之查詢慢原因和解決技巧的文章就介紹到這了,更多相關(guān)MySQL查詢優(yōu)化內(nèi)容請搜索腳本之家以前的文章或繼續(xù)瀏覽下面的相關(guān)文章希望大家以后多多支持腳本之家!

您可能感興趣的文章:
  • 一篇文章弄懂MySQL查詢語句的執(zhí)行過程
  • 詳解MySQL 查詢語句的執(zhí)行過程
  • Python使用sql語句對mysql數(shù)據(jù)庫多條件模糊查詢的思路詳解
  • mysql查詢的控制語句圖文詳解
  • Mysql將查詢結(jié)果集轉(zhuǎn)換為JSON數(shù)據(jù)的實例代碼
  • 使用Visual Studio Code連接MySql數(shù)據(jù)庫并進(jìn)行查詢
  • mysql聚合統(tǒng)計數(shù)據(jù)查詢緩慢的優(yōu)化方法
  • MySQL多表查詢的具體實例
  • mysql從一張表查詢批量數(shù)據(jù)并插入到另一表中的完整實例
  • 分析mysql中一條SQL查詢語句是如何執(zhí)行的

標(biāo)簽:吉林 隨州 荊州 錦州 黑河 資陽 甘南 滄州

巨人網(wǎng)絡(luò)通訊聲明:本文標(biāo)題《MySQL查詢優(yōu)化之查詢慢原因和解決技巧》,本文關(guān)鍵詞  MySQL,查詢,優(yōu)化,之,慢,原因,;如發(fā)現(xiàn)本文內(nèi)容存在版權(quán)問題,煩請?zhí)峁┫嚓P(guān)信息告之我們,我們將及時溝通與處理。本站內(nèi)容系統(tǒng)采集于網(wǎng)絡(luò),涉及言論、版權(quán)與本站無關(guān)。
  • 相關(guān)文章
  • 下面列出與本文章《MySQL查詢優(yōu)化之查詢慢原因和解決技巧》相關(guān)的同類信息!
  • 本頁收集關(guān)于MySQL查詢優(yōu)化之查詢慢原因和解決技巧的相關(guān)信息資訊供網(wǎng)民參考!
  • 推薦文章
    91九色国产蝌蚪| 欧美在线激情| 午夜精品在线| 五月天国产在线| 久久91精品久久久久久秒播| 亚洲欧洲美洲综合色网| 国产乱子视频| 日本视频在线观看免费| 国产成人亚洲综合91精品| 日本一区二区三区四区视频| 一本色道88久久加勒比精品| 亚洲视频精选| 99久久精品一区| 这里只有精品在线观看视频| 亚洲男女在线观看| 国产一卡二卡在线| 欧美xxxx性猛交bbbb| 亚洲精品卡一卡二| 国产片乱18免费| 九色porny视频在线观看| www精品久久| 激情在线视频播放| 久久精品日产第一区二区三区精品版| 亚洲综合在线中文字幕| 中文字幕视频在线观看| 色婷婷综合久久| 亚洲自拍偷拍网| 亚洲色图制服丝袜| 日韩精品成人在线观看| 户外极限露出调教在线视频| 色综合色综合色综合| 久久精品在这里| 欧美日韩一区三区| 人妻精品无码一区二区| www浪潮av99com| 最新国产精品精品视频| aaa黄色大片| 免费日韩av| 国产高清精品一区二区| 国产一区欧美一区| 成人动漫一区二区| 欧美精品色哟哟| 自拍偷拍视频亚洲| 老司机在线看片网av| 久久精品国产99久久99久久久| 在线国产视频| 色999日韩国产欧美一区二区| 红桃视频一区二区三区免费| 成人的网站免费观看| 日本公妇乱淫免费视频一区三区| 四虎av网址| 欧美午夜无遮挡| 97一区二区国产好的精华液| 国产精品视频午夜| 国产综合精品在线| 激情五月婷婷网| 美女三级黄色片| av影片在线播放| 91久久精品| 一级特黄aaa大片在线观看| 91精品久久久久久久| 日韩人妻精品无码一区二区三区| 17c丨国产丨精品视频| 国产乱码精品一区二区| 久久亚洲道色| 精品制服美女丁香| 亚洲国产精品二十页| 国产精品自偷自拍| 成人在线免费播放视频| 亚洲伊人网在线观看| 久久久一区二区三区| 欧美四级电影在线观看| 国产成人午夜精品5599| 国产亚洲人成网站| 97成人资源| 亚洲综合久久久| 午夜国产一区二区三区| 亚洲欧洲精品一区二区三区波多野1战4| 成人日韩视频| 亚洲成人福利在线观看| 亚洲电影激情视频网站| 日韩美女在线看免费观看| 黑人极品videos精品欧美裸| a屁视频一区二区三区四区| 国产精品久久久久久久成人午夜| 91精品国产美女浴室洗澡无遮挡| 欧美日韩在线观看一区| 日本午夜在线| 手机在线成人av| 久久精品一区二区三区av| 免费一级a毛片夜夜看| 久久高清免费视频| 欧美美女视频| 国产精品天堂蜜av在线播放| 色偷偷7777www人| 国产成人精品免费一区二区| 污视频网站在线看| www.久久91| 成年人网站av| 中文字幕一区二区三区有限公司| 欧美自拍偷拍一区| 99视频一区二区三区| 在线视频二区| 少妇人妻一区二区| 久久99亚洲热视| 手机在线成人免费视频| 亚洲网址在线观看| 亚洲欧洲激情在线乱码蜜桃| 你懂的国产精品| 另类综合图区| 婷婷色中文字幕| 日韩在线高清视频| 蜜臀av一级做a爰片久久| 欧美激情偷拍自拍| 啪啪导航网站| 国内一区二区视频| 最近中文字幕mv免费高清在线| 最新一区二区三区| 尤物视频在线| 欧美国产日韩电影| 国产精品你懂的在线欣赏| 在线观看一二三区| 成人国产精品日本在线| 欧美另类xxx| 欧美精品在线视频观看| 91在线不卡| 久久99久久人婷婷精品综合| 亚洲视频网站在线| 春意影院在线| 欧美狂欢多p性派对| 亚洲美女自拍偷拍| 亚洲免费伊人电影在线观看av| 国产人久久人人人人爽| 中文字幕视频精品一区二区三区| 欧美日韩p片| 中文字幕av在线播放| 色欲av无码一区二区三区| 国产一区二区三区免费观看在线| 亚洲第一视频网站| 国产成人精品在线| 国产a∨精品一区二区三区仙踪林| 精品乱码一区二区三区四区| 久热re这里精品视频在线6| 国产麻豆视频网站| 精品国产凹凸成av人导航| 久久婷婷综合中文字幕| 欧美日韩精品一区二区三区视频| 久久国产人妖系列| 午夜精品福利在线观看| 韩国女同性做爰三级| 视频直播国产精品| 欧美重口另类| 午夜精品福利视频| 无码日韩精品一区二区免费| 日本aⅴ亚洲精品中文乱码| 国产一线在线观看| 人操人视频在线观看| 亚洲欧美综合在线观看| 久久国产精品99国产精| 久久婷婷五月综合色丁香| 久久久xxx| 欧美日韩国产影片| 亚洲乱码国产乱码精品精| 国产又粗又长又大的视频| 亚洲无码精品在线播放| 国产在线高潮| 亚洲欧洲国产伦综合| 在线观看国产成人| 国产一区二区三区黄| 人妻巨大乳一二三区| 欧美成人国产精品高潮| 在线看片福利| 91精品国产综合久久婷婷香蕉| 成人午夜视频精品一区| 要久久爱电视剧全集完整观看| 一本色道久久综合无码人妻| 国内揄拍国内精品久久| 日韩av第一页| 99热这里只有精品1| 欧美精品中文| 久草福利在线视频| 日韩中文字幕免费在线观看| 成人免费毛片aaaaa**| 欧美夫妻性生活视频| 成人亚洲视频在线观看| 日韩av午夜| 成年无码av片在线| 欧美成人亚洲高清在线观看| 国产成人无码aa精品一区| 亚洲国产精品综合小说图片区| 国产一区二区免费| 久久精品国产亚洲一区二区| 国产一区二区三区四区在线观看| 欧美日韩国产色综合一二三四| av中文字幕一区| 亚洲在线播放电影| 91伊人久久大香线蕉| 国产一区二区三区高清| 免费a漫导航| 国产伦精品一区二区免费| 992tv在线成人免费观看| 亚洲男女视频在线观看| 91亚洲精品视频在线观看| 日产福利视频在线观看| 人妻少妇被粗大爽9797pw| 97久久人国产精品婷婷| 国产色婷婷在线| 欧美一区二区三区……| 成人av免费| 日韩精品免费在线视频观看| 看女生喷水的网站在线观看| 女同毛片一区二区三区| 亚洲精品伊人| 久久久久久色| 不卡av电影在线观看| 亚洲尤物影院| 亚洲精品一区在线| 91视频一区二区三区| 国产午夜激情视频| 免费观看av网站| 亚洲欧美在线人成swag| 99爱在线观看| 日韩黄色大片| 欧美国产日韩a欧美在线观看| 国产黄a三级三级三级| 91 com成人网| 国产三级日本三级在线播放| 欧美壮男野外gaytube| 538国产精品一区二区免费视频| 四虎国产精品成人免费4hu| 国产麻豆一区二区三区精品视频| 欧美v亚洲v| 国产无套精品一区二区| 国产精品一二三区在线| 亚洲精品中文字幕av| 久久av资源站| av综合网址| 亚洲成人av一区| 激情视频国产| 五月综合色婷婷| 免费看国产一级片| 亚洲自偷自拍熟女另类| 中文字幕一区二区三区四区久久| 成人在线播放视频| 伊人伊人av电影| 一个人看的日本www的免费视频| 国产成人免费高清视频| 自拍偷拍亚洲色图欧美| 青娱乐精品视频在线| 亚洲三级视频| 九九热在线视频免费观看| 亚洲一线在线观看| 亚洲国产电影| 欧美亚洲韩国| 国产aⅴ精品一区二区三区色成熟| 中国女人内谢25xxxx免费视频| 亚洲**2019国产| 成人福利网站| 久久久久成人黄色影片| 日韩漫画puputoon| av免费在线网址| 自拍偷拍第1页| 亚洲视频在线观看免费| 欧美人妻精品一区二区免费看| 国产男女无遮挡猛进猛出| 2001个疯子在线观看| 天天操天天爽天天干| 日本肉体xxxx裸体xxx免费| 麻豆一区二区在线| 日韩精品免费一线在线观看| 精品国产乱码久久久久久闺蜜| 国产乱码在线观看| 欧美色老头old∨ideo| 欧美亚洲日本一区| 色综合色综合| 国产精品日日摸夜夜爽| 能在线看的av| 久久综合之合合综合久久| 韩国三级电影一区二区| 日韩欧美视频第二区| 五月天婷婷基地| 欧美精品中文字幕亚洲专区| 国产视频网站在线| 亚洲伦伦在线| 欧美成人三区| 麻豆传媒网站在线观看| 国产欧美一区二区在线观看| 在线免费观看日本欧美| 美女日韩在线中文字幕| 日韩在线二区| 国精产品一区| 国产精品x8x8一区二区| 久久亚洲欧美国产精品乐播| 亚洲国产高潮在线观看| 亚州一区二区| 欧美精品一区二区三区国产精品| 精品少妇人妻av免费久久洗澡| 宅男噜噜99国产精品观看免费| 亚洲精品欧美综合四区| 国产成人亚洲综合青青| 日本在线视频www鲁啊鲁| 色橹橹高清视频在线播放| 一本一道久久a久久精品综合蜜臀| 亚洲人成在线网站| 欧美精品激情blacked18| 国产精品劲爆视频| a在线视频观看| 波霸ol色综合网| 色吊一区二区三区| 亚洲午夜精品久久久久久浪潮| 国产乱色精品成人免费视频| 九色porny丨国产精品| 亚洲品质自拍| 91精品xxx在线观看| 在线免费观看日本欧美| 亚洲一区二区三区黄色| 国外成人性视频| 狠狠躁日日躁夜夜躁av| 国产精品久久久久国产精品日日| 秋霞无码一区二区| 国产一级二级av| 日本不卡一二三| 成人盗摄视频| 无码人妻精品一区二区中文| 欧美尺度大的性做爰视频| 黑人巨大精品欧美一区二区小视频| 色噜噜一区二区三区| 极品销魂美女一区二区三区|